Our Community<br />

Auxiliaries<br />

<strong>Colac</strong> <strong>Area</strong> <strong>Health</strong> (CAH) recognises the valuable<br />

contribution <strong>of</strong> our Auxiliary members over<br />

many years. The members have raised thous<strong>and</strong>s<br />

<strong>of</strong> dollars which has enabled CAH to purchase<br />

equipment, furnishings <strong>and</strong> fittings to benefit the<br />

community when using the <strong>Health</strong> Service. In<br />

August 2008, CAH was presented with a cheque for<br />

$3,000 by the <strong>Colac</strong> Auxiliary.<br />

The Birregurra Community <strong>Health</strong> Centre Auxiliary<br />

continues to support the Community <strong>Health</strong><br />

Centre at Birregurra <strong>and</strong> provides ongoing<br />

fundraising which assists with the purchase <strong>of</strong><br />

equipment for the Centre. The Auxiliary provided a<br />

further donation <strong>of</strong> $1,400 in June <strong>2009</strong>.<br />

Community Partnerships<br />

Blue Ribbon Foundation<br />

A small but dedicated committee came together<br />

seven years ago with a novel idea to host a rodeo<br />

in <strong>Colac</strong>. This event became part <strong>of</strong> the New Year<br />

calendar for many, attracting enthusiastic crowds.<br />

Due to circumstances beyond our control, the 2008<br />

Rodeo was cancelled. In January <strong>2009</strong> the Rodeo<br />

was again held at the <strong>Colac</strong> Showgrounds <strong>and</strong><br />

attended by a large crowd. This event will continue<br />

to raise awareness <strong>of</strong> this important foundation<br />

while raising funds to purchase vital equipment for<br />

the Emergency Department at CAH.<br />

Volunteers<br />

<strong>Colac</strong> <strong>Area</strong> <strong>Health</strong> currently has 150 registered<br />

volunteers, excluding palliative care volunteers.<br />

These volunteers continue to be recognised as<br />

a vital part <strong>of</strong> CAH <strong>and</strong> provide assistance in the<br />

following areas:<br />

- Adult Day Activity Program<br />

- <strong>Colac</strong> <strong>Area</strong> <strong>Health</strong> Auxiliaries<br />

- Neighbourhood House<br />

- Flower Ladies<br />

- Pastoral Visitors<br />

- Residential Aged <strong>Care</strong><br />
